Top 5 Entertainment Android Apps in Chile: Q3 2024 Performance

In the third quarter of 2024, the entertainment app landscape on the Android platform in Chile showcased dynamic trends across various metrics. Sensor Tower's data reveals intriguing patterns in downloads, revenue, and active usage for the top five entertainment apps.

Max: Stream HBO, TV, & Movies saw a notable increase in weekly revenue, peaking at around $47K in mid-August. Downloads fluctuated, hitting a high of 86K in early August before settling around 47K by the end of September. The app's active user base grew steadily, from approximately 509K at the start of July to 764K by the end of the quarter.

DramaBox - Stream Drama Shorts experienced a stable revenue stream, with weekly earnings hovering around $20K, reaching $22K in the last week of September. Downloads showed a downward trend from a July high of 92K to roughly 41K at the end of the quarter. Active users similarly decreased from 138K in early July to around 128K at the quarter's close.

Disney+ maintained a consistent revenue flow, with weekly figures around $97K, dipping slightly in August but recovering by September's end. Downloads peaked at 92K in July but dropped to 22K by late September. Active user numbers remained relatively stable, with minor fluctuations, ending the quarter at approximately 146K.

ShortMax - Watch Dramas & Show showed a gradual increase in revenue, peaking at $14.7K in late September. Download trends were more volatile, surging to 95K in mid-September before dropping to 16K by the quarter's end. Active users increased significantly, reaching a peak of 132K in mid-September before declining to about 85K.

ReelShort - Short Movie & TV demonstrated varied revenue, peaking at $15.6K in mid-August before settling around $8.1K by the end of September. Downloads mirrored this volatility, peaking at 69K in August but dropping to 9.6K by late September. The active user base followed a similar pattern, reaching 95K in August but declining to 22K by the quarter's conclusion.
